Lap Band is Now FDA Approved

Lap Band Surgery - Involves placing an inflatable silicone band around the upper portion of the stomach. It reduces the size of the stomach limiting the amount a patient can eat. This procedure is a better alternative to gastric bypass surgery because its reversible.
